Size
Check out how much room you have, and that any furniture you need to move when you are opening your instant bed needs to be easy to move. Also, how is your fold out sofa going to look with the rest of the room? A grey sofa bed will compliment your décor, providing a classic look that can be accessorised with bolder colours like yellow and mustard. Looking for something more traditional? A leather sofa bed will be a timeless addition to your furniture, and come in a range of colours. They look like a conventional sofa so will blend in with your other lounge furniture, and are sturdy enough to sleep regular overnight guests. Another great option are corner sofa beds which can give you a lot of seating and sleeping area for their size, and they tend to have sturdy mechanisms so will be a great investment. If you are looking for something a bit different then a futon bed can look stylish, be it with a wooden or metal frame, however they are best for occasional use. Kid’s rooms are place where a single sofa bed or a click clac sofa bed will come in handy – sit on them during story time, and handy too for those sleep overs. Many come with removable covers or can be wiped clean.
Bed sofa mechanism
Another important feature to consider is the mechanism. A sofa bed with a foldout mattress is one where the seat and cushions fold out onto the floor creating a mattress. With a clic clac sofa bed, the mechanism on the backrest of this bed settee pushes down flat then clicks into position, so there is no danger of it collapsing in the middle of the night. Another mechanism is that of the pull-out bed frame where a metal frame is located under the seat of the sofa and it is pulled out to create the bed with a frame to support it from underneath.
